Webwithin-subjects design an experimental design in which the effects of treatments are seen through the comparison of scores of the same participant observed under all the treatment conditions. For example, teachers may want to give a pre- and postcourse survey of skills and attitudes to gauge how much both changed as a result of the course. WebThe within-subjects design is more efficient for the researcher and controls extraneous participant variables. Since factorial designs have more than one independent variable, it is also possible to manipulate one independent variable between subjects and another within subjects. This is called a mixed factorial design.
